E66 LRU is a 1987 Harley Davidson Fxr in Orange with a 1,340c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.2%.
Across all 1987 Harley Davidson Fxr models, the average MOT pass rate is 91.1% with a typical mileage of 15,814 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Harley Davidson Fxr fails its MOT is stop lamp does not illuminate immediately a brake applies, accounting for 35 recorded failures. If you're considering buying E66 LRU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Harley Davidson Fxr typically stays on UK roads for around 44 years. At 39 years old, this Harley Davidson Fxr is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
